 -- LEARNING OUTCOMES OF THE COURSE UNIT
Students comprehend the importance of language for human beings.
Students recognize the diffence between languange and word.
Students understand the science of structural language.
Students recognize 20. century linguistic theories and theorists.
Students comprehend the importance of the semantic as a branch of linguistics.
Students comprehend the indicator in terms of semantics.
Students distinguish non-language indicators and language indicator.
Students comprehend context, the connotation, the value of emotion terms.
Students comments on meaning events of language.
Students evaluate the meaning of scientific concepts like scientific the theory of action, discourse,implicit meaning.

 --COURSE CONTENT
1. Week   Human and language
2. Week   Language word discrimination
3. Week   Language and communication
4. Week   Concepts and conceptualisation
5. Week   The language acquisition and the science of acquisition
6. Week   Structural linguistics
7. Week   20. century linguistics theories and theorists
8. Week   Midterm exam
9. Week   Semantics
10. Week  Indicator
11. Week   Non-language indicators and language indicators
12. Week   Context, the connotation, value of emotion
13. Week   Word-action theory
14. Week   Events of meaning
15. Week   Events of meaning
16. Week  Final exam
